Output 53e34254731bd53496a9a040d0e7a98709b3eab6d854bca6acc13af090809ecb:66

value
96821
script pubkey
OP_0 OP_PUSHBYTES_20 dc3e32b7317af3183d63f57d2d0d3bb462d3aca9
address
bc1qmslr9de30te3s0tr747j6rfmk33d8t9fpqsy6s
transaction
53e34254731bd53496a9a040d0e7a98709b3eab6d854bca6acc13af090809ecb
spent
true